MORIGAON: A complaint was filed against Maharashtra MLA Baburao Kadu at Morigaon Police Station. The complaint was filed seeking legal action against Maharashtra Prahar Janashakti Dal MLA Prakash Baburao Kadu for his remarks regarding Assamese people and dogs during the recent Maharashtra Assembly session. The charges were filed by the chief advisor of MASS as well as the former president of Morigaon District Sahitya Sabha, Bubumoni Goswami. The MLA’s remarks in the Maharashtra Assembly are deliberate and untrue. His such untrue remarks will spread wrong message about Assam and could destroy harmony between the people of the two states and create communal hatred. The complaint also alleged that such remarks would harm the tourism and hotel business in Assam.
